MEDERMA SCAR CREAM is a topical scar treatment formulated to improve the appearance of old and new scars, including surgical scars, acne scars, burns, and stretch marks. It works by hydrating the skin and promoting healthy tissue regeneration.


Composition

  • Active Ingredients:

    • Cepalin® (Allium cepa extract) – Reduces redness and inflammation.

    • Hyaluronic Acid – Hydrates and plumps scar tissue.

    • Allantoin – Promotes skin healing and softening.

  • Inactive Ingredients:

    • Water, xanthan gum, PEG-40 hydrogenated castor oil, fragrance.

(Note: Some variants may contain sunscreen for daytime use.)


Mechanism of Action

  • Reduces scar thickness & redness by modulating collagen production.

  • Improves skin elasticity through deep hydration.

  • Softens and smoothes raised or discolored scars.


Dosage & Application

  • For New Scars:

    • Apply 3–4 times daily for 8 weeks.

  • For Old Scars:

    • Apply 3–4 times daily for 3–6 months (longer use may improve results).

  • How to Use:

    1. Clean and dry the scar area.

    2. Massage a thin layer gently into the scar for 1–2 minutes.

    3. Let it absorb fully before covering with clothing.


Uses

  1. Post-Surgical Scars (C-section, stitches, etc.).

  2. Acne Scars & Keloids.

  3. Burn Scars & Stretch Marks.

  4. Traumatic Scars (cuts, abrasions).


Storage

  • Store at room temperature (15–25°C).

  • Keep the tube tightly closed.


Recommendations

  • Start early (once the wound is fully closed).

  • Use sunscreen on scars exposed to sunlight (prevents darkening).

  • Consistency is key – Daily use yields best results.


Important Notes

Side Effects

  • Rare: Mild irritation, itching, or redness (discontinue if severe).

  • Avoid contact with eyes.

Contraindications

  • Open wounds or infected skin.

  • Known allergy to onion extract (Cepalin®).

Effectiveness

  • Works best on hypertrophic and red scars (less effective on mature white scars).

  • Visible improvement typically seen after 4–8 weeks.

For optimal results, combine with scar massage and sun protection.
